How much do service operations coordinator j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 8, 2026, the average hourly pay for service operations coordinator in Texas is $23.07,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$18.37 and $25.96 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a service operations coordinator do?

A service operations coordinator manages and oversees daily service delivery processes to ensure efficiency and customer satisfaction. They coordinate between teams, monitor performance metrics, and may use tools like CRM or service management software to streamline operations and resolve issues promptly.

What is the difference between Service Operations Coordinator vs Customer Service Representative?

AspectService Operations CoordinatorCustomer Service Representative
Primary RoleOversees service delivery processes, manages operational workflows, and coordinates between teams to ensure service quality.Handles customer inquiries, provides support, and resolves issues directly with clients.
Required SkillsOperational management, communication, problem-solving, and organizational skills.Customer communication, problem resolution, patience, and product knowledge.
Work EnvironmentOffice setting, cross-departmental collaboration, often involved in planning and process improvement.Call centers, retail, or online support environments focused on direct customer interaction.
Common CertificationsCustomer service certifications, project management, or operations-related credentials.Customer service certifications, communication skills training.

The Service Operations Coordinator focuses on managing service processes and ensuring operational efficiency, while the Customer Service Representative primarily interacts directly with customers to address their needs. Both roles require strong communication skills but differ in scope and responsibilities within the service industry.

How much do service operations coordinators make in the US?

Service operations coordinators in the US typically earn between $45,000 and $70,000 annually, depending on experience, location, and industry. Entry-level roles may start around $40,000, while experienced coordinators can earn over $75,000 with additional certifications or specialized skills.

Job description

Job Type
Full-time
Description
The Operations Coordinator is responsible for coordinating daily operational activities, dispatch execution, operational administration, documentation control, settlements, vendor coordination, purchasing support, and internal communication. This role serves as the administrative and operational support partner to the Director of Operations and Yard Manager. The Operations Coordinator ensures operational processes are organized, documented, communicated, and executed effectively while supporting service delivery, driver coordination, customer service execution, and continuous process improvement. The position acts as the central coordination point between operations, drivers, customers, vendors, accounting, and leadership.
Requirements
I. Dispatch & Service Coordination
Own daily service coordination and dispatch execution.
Responsibilities
โ€ข Schedule pickups, swaps, roll-offs, and service requests
โ€ข Coordinate routes with drivers and operations
โ€ข Monitor service completion throughout the day
โ€ข Communicate scheduling updates to customers
โ€ข Confirm service appointments
โ€ข Resolve scheduling conflicts and route issues
โ€ข Coordinate emergency service requests
โ€ข Track service completion and customer requests
โ€ข Maintain dispatch records and documentation
โ€ข Ensure all service requests are executed accurately and on time
